Morphin is a Python-based video player that is easy to use and utilizes Gtk+ and Gstreamer technology. Its simple design makes it user-friendly.
The interface is simple and clutter-free, making it effortless to use. Morphin also has the added advantage of quick startup times. If you have to stop playback and then resume, Morphin makes it possible to pick up exactly from where you left off, without feeling lost.
The video player has an intuitive interface for selecting the last played video files, making it quite convenient to navigate the content you've already watched. Other features include video display settings such as brightness, contrast and hue, as well as, video aspect settings.
To run Morphin, users need to have Python 2.5, PyGTK 2.10, Gstreamer 0.10, and ConfigObj installed on their computers.
In the latest release, Morphin has added a new volume control feature, and a setup script that makes it easier to install the application.
